On July 2, 2026, the SPRINT Center, through its extension project โ€œImproving and Revitalizing the Opportunities for ๐˜’๐˜ข๐˜ฐ๐˜ฏ๐˜จ (IROK) Farmers towards a Better Quality of Lifeโ€, in collaboration with the Office of the Provincial Cooperatives Development Officer (OPCDO), conducted an activity entitled โ€œ๐‹๐ž๐š๐๐ž๐ซ๐ฌ๐ก๐ข๐ฉ ๐š๐ง๐ ๐‚๐จ๐จ๐ฉ๐ž๐ซ๐š๐ญ๐ข๐ฏ๐ž ๐ƒ๐ž๐ฏ๐ž๐ฅ๐จ๐ฉ๐ฆ๐ž๐ง๐ญ ๐“๐ซ๐š๐ข๐ง๐ข๐ง๐  ๐Ÿ๐จ๐ซ ๐’๐ฎ๐ ๐š๐ซ ๐๐š๐ฅ๐ฆ ๐’๐ญ๐š๐ค๐ž๐ก๐จ๐ฅ๐๐ž๐ซ๐ฌ ๐“๐จ๐ฐ๐š๐ซ๐๐ฌ ๐’๐ฎ๐ฌ๐ญ๐š๐ข๐ง๐š๐›๐ฅ๐ž ๐’๐จ๐œ๐ข๐š๐ฅ ๐„๐ง๐ญ๐ž๐ซ๐ฉ๐ซ๐ข๐ฌ๐žโ€ at the SPRINT Center Training Hall (๐˜‰๐˜ถ๐˜ญ๐˜ธ๐˜ข๐˜จ๐˜ข๐˜ฏ๐˜จ ๐˜๐˜ณ๐˜ฐ๐˜ฌ), Cavite State University.

The seminar covered the following topics:
โ€ข Empowering ๐˜’๐˜ข๐˜ฐ๐˜ฏ๐˜จ Farmers to Become Visionary Leaders by Mr. Gener T. Cueno, Director of CvSU-CLAPP-RT
โ€ข Basic Concepts and Philosophy of Cooperatives and How to Organize Cooperative? by Ms. Ma. Gwendolyn L. Janohan, Cooperative Development Specialist II, OPCDO
โ€ข Organizational Structure of a Cooperative by Ms. Kyla Joryz B. Ramos, Cooperative Development Specialist II, OPCDO
โ€ข Awareness on Food Safety and Good Manufacturing Practices by Ms. Liza C. Gabatan, Development Management Officer IV, OPCDO
โ€ข Orientation on GMP & FDA Registration by Ms. Annalyn S. Hernandez, Development Management Officer III, OPCDO

The activity was attended by sugar palm farmers, processors, and traders from Indang and Magallanes, Cavite, as well as a representative from LGU-Indang.

On June 25, 2026, the Sugar Palm Research, Information, and Trade (SPRINT) Center, through its extension project Improving and Revitalizing the Opportunities for Kaong (IROK) Farmers towards a Better Quality of Life, in collaboration with the College of Agriculture, Food, Environment and Natural Resources - Institute of Food Science and Technology (CAFENR-IFST), conducted a webinar entitled โ€œQuality Evaluation and Monitoring of Kaong Products: Ensuring Safety, Consistency, and Market Readinessโ€ via Google Meet.

The webinar covered the following topics by faculty members of CAFENR-IFST as the resource speakers:
"Food Safety and Good Manufacturing Practices" discussed by Ms. Remilyn V. Concepcion;
"Sensory Evaluation of Kaong Product" discussed by Ms. Heidi P. Paler;
"Quality Control of Kaong Product" discussed by Ms. Aitee Janelle E. Reterta; and
"Quality Assurance of Kaong Products" discussed by Ms. Marie Abigail I. Cortado.

It was attended by the sugar palm farmers, processors, and traders, as well as students, members of CvSU, and other agencies.

The Philippine Association for Graduate Education (PAGE) Region IV-A, led by Dr. Ramon C. Maniago, conducted an extension activity entitled "PAGE 4A Brings Kaong Back" on June 24, 2026, at Brgy. Kaytambog, Indang, Cavite, in collaboration with the Cavite State University - Sugar Palm Research, Information, and Trade (SPRINT) Center, headed by Dr. Edgardo A. Gonzales, the International and Local Collaboration and Linkages Office (ILCLO) headed by Asso. Prof. Ma. Veronica P. Peรฑaflorida, and the Brgy. Kaytambog Officials, headed by Hon. Kristopher C. Romen, with the participation of members of the Kaytambog Farmers Association.

The activity aims to contribute to environmental conservation and sustainable livelihood development through the promotion and re-establishment of sugar palm (๐˜ฌ๐˜ข๐˜ฐ๐˜ฏ๐˜จ) in the local community.

On March 26, 2026, the SPRINT Center, through its extension project Improving and Revitalizing the Opportunities for Kaong (IROK) Farmers towards a Better Quality of Life, in collaboration with the Gender and Development Resource Center (GADRC), conducted an activity entitled โ€œSeminar on Addressing Gender Issues for Sustainable Business Development of Sugar Palm Stakeholdersโ€, at the SPRINT Center Training Hall (Bulwagang Irok), Cavite State University, Indang, Cavite.

The seminar covered the following topics:
Gender Sensitive Orientation, and Sweet Empowerment: Uplifting Women through Kaong Enterprise, by Asst. Prof. Thea Maries P. Perez, GAD Resource Pool Member and Department Extension Coordinator of CEMDS;
Branding and Social Media Management by Dr. Tania Marie P. Melo, Director of Public Affairs and Communications Office (PACO); and
Orientation for DOLE Forms and Procedures by Ms. Marites A. Espineli, Livelihood Development Specialist of DOLE-Cavite

Additionally, the Extension Services Center administered a Client Satisfaction Survey (CSS) to further improve the effectiveness of the Extension Program/Project by systematically collecting and analyzing beneficiary feedback.

The activity was attended by sugar palm farmers, processors, and traders from Indang, Magallanes, and Alfonso, Cavite, as well as a representative from the Office of the Municipal Agriculturist of Indang, Cavite.

Cavite State University SPRINT Center strengthens its collaboration with the Municipal Government of Magallanes, Cavite through the Memorandum of Agreement (MOA) Signing, held on March 02, 2026 at the Magallanes Municipal Covered Court, supporting the development of a sustainable sugar palm industry in upland Cavite.

Through Project IROK (Improving and Revitalizing the Opportunities for Kaong Farmers towards a Better Quality of Life), efforts in capacity building, technology transfer, and community empowerment continue to support local sugar palm stakeholders.

Present at the MOA Signing were Hon. Janessa Ann Maligaya de Ramayo, Municipal Mayor of Magallanes, and Dr. Melbourne R. Talactac, CvSU Vice President for Research, Innovation, and Extension, joined by Engr. Freddie D. Sisante, Municipal Agriculturist of Magallanes; Edgardo A. Gonzales, SPRINT Center Director; Karen Krista E. Cajilis, Project IROK Leader; and SPRINT Center personnel.
